Man who killed girlfriend with 258 knife stitches sentenced to five years in prison and TBS

The court in The Hague has sentenced Arnold O. on Wednesday to five years in prison and compulsory psychiatric treatment. In July last year, the man killed his girlfriend by stabbing her 258 times with a knife in her home in Zoetermeer.

The verdict is not in line with the Public Prosecution Service (OM) demand. The OM had demanded ten years in prison and compulsory psychiatric treatment.

According to the court, the crime “absolutely belongs to the outer category in terms of violence and gruesomeness”. According to experts, O. was psychotic at the time of the crime. The court considers him to be partially accountable.

O. committed the crime in the presence of their two-week-old baby. He filmed the 22-year-old woman during the stabbing with her own phone. Then he took a selfie with the baby, who remained unharmed. He later stated that he took the photo because he would not see the baby for a long time.

At the time of the photo, the police were already at the door. They were alerted by a nurse from the consultation center, who was going to visit mother and child. O. was arrested on the spot.

O. had previously been convicted of assaulting the victim. He had just been released from a prison sentence of ninety days a month.

The perpetrator accused his girlfriend of cheating. In addition, he thought that possibly not him, but another man was the father of the baby. But according to the public prosecutor, nothing points to this. “It was in his head, it was a delusion.”

The victim’s family was concerned about the poor relationship. They were about to accommodate her with family in Belgium. The suspect and the victim already lived separately.
